Iraqi Prime Minister Adil Abdul Mahdi says he will resign— but wtf is happening with Iran?
(This article is a little older but I feel like we need context)
A lot of things have been happening outside of our view. For the last two months there have been widespread protests demanding the resignation of Prime Minister Adil Abdul Mahdi. The protests were sparked by the youth who are tired of the longstanding unemployment, government corruption, and a lack of basic services— such as electricity and clean water. The Iraqi government has tried to regain control with the use of lethal force, while also imposing curfews and internet blackouts— In total, around 380 people have been killed and 17,745 injured in Iraq since the protests began, according to Ali Al-Bayati, a member of the Independent High Commission for Human Rights of Iraq. Latinas emerge as a powerful force in the U.S. job market
“Today, 61% of Latinas are participating in the labor force — higher than the 59% national rate for females overall, according to the November job report. By 2028, they are forecast to account for 9.2% of the total labor force, up from 7.5% in 2018, according to the Bureau of Labor Statistics. Latinos — both women and men — will account for a fifth of the worker pool by then.” BUT —we are still underpaid.

These Nine Pennsylvania Lawmakers Just Asked the Supreme Court to Overturn Roe v. Wade
“Nine Pennsylvania lawmakers signed on to an amicus (“friend of the court”) brief authored by Americans United for Life (AUL) and filed with the U.S. Supreme Court in June Medical Services v. Gee. In the brief, they call on the U.S. Supreme Court to reach beyond the case itself and overturn both Roe v. Wade and Planned Parenthood v. Casey. AUL is an organization that writes and advocates for anti-abortion and anti-choice legislation. The group has taken credit for authoring one-third of the abortion restrictions enacted between 2011 and 2014.”
